Bottled 2020. Warm marmalade on the nose, with btter-sweet citrus fruit. A delightful intensity of flavour on the palate. A rich set of flavours backed by generous lemon acidity. There is considerable sugar on the palate, but this is nicely balanced by the acidity. The wine delivers a long lemon finish. This is a big and powerful wine, very persistent and very impressive. 92/100. Tasted 16-May-2024.

1970 TSHT. Med dark tawny, mahogany, some brown. Nose is primarily dried citrus fruits and vinagrinho. Round and mouth-filling, with a somewhat dry finish. Intense due to the simultaneous high levels of sugar and acidity. Superb overall, with a persistent, long finish. 96 points. (Tied for 2nd on the night for me with the VVO Coronation Port, and behind the 1961 TSHT.)
